We have two crews going this summer. When we went in '02 we were introduced
to the concept of bartering. The Clear Creek staff offered us 12 oranges
and spoon (the crew leader left his lexan spoon at a sump) for an item or
two. Since we didn't know about backcountry bartering before, we didn't
have anything else for later in the trek. Does anyone bring barter items
(just in case) and what seems to be successful . and lightweight?
